Clinician-Specific Benefits Include:

  • Paid Malpractice Insurance (Occurrence-Based)
  • CME Reimbursement + CME Time
  • Support for Qualified FQHC Loan Repayment Programs:
  • National Health Service Corps (NHSC) – Pays up to $50,000 for every 2 years of service at an FQHC
  • Texas Physician Education Loan Repayment Program (PELRP) – Pays up to $180,000

Key Responsibilities

  • Serve as the clinical lead and direct supervisor for primary care providers at your designated site.
  • Facilitate schedule optimization, coverage planning, and implementation of clinical workflows in collaboration with the Site Director.
  • Foster provider behavior and professionalism to align with Legacy Community Health's values and standards.
  • Educate and guide clinic providers on new initiatives and projects, supporting their implementation and monitoring progress.
  • Collaborate closely with operational and nursing leadership to enhance clinic performance and service delivery.

Qualifications and Experience

  • Medical Doctorate (MD or DO) from an accredited medical school.
  • Possession of a current Texas medical license.
  • Board Certification in a Primary Care Specialty: Pediatrics, OB/GYN, Internal Medicine, or Family Practice.
  • Minimum of 3 years of clinical experience post-residency, showcasing expertise and commitment.
  • Proven leadership or management experience in a healthcare setting.
  • Experience in community healthcare, with a track record of supporting cross-departmental clinical programs.

About Legacy Community Health

As the largest Federally Qualified Health Center (FQHC) in Southeast Texas, Legacy Community Health has been delivering comprehensive, high-quality, and affordable health care for nearly 40 years.

With more than 50 clinics across the Greater Houston and Gulf Coast region, we continue to grow strategically and invest in our communities. By innovating how care is delivered, we've stayed at the forefront of connecting our communities to health—every day, in every way.
